Message type: E = Error
Message class: 56 - HR TRAVEL: Messages for Trip Costs Dialog
Message number: 726
Message text: The end date can not be set back
The end date lies in a period which has been canceled, but the period
cancelation has not yet been transferred.
The system issues an error message and will not allow you to continue with this transaction until the error is resolved.
Transfer the canceled period, then the duration of the action can be
limited to the relevant date.

SAP messages fall into 3 different categories: Error messages
(message type = E), Warnings (W) or Informational (I) messages.
An error message will prevent you from continuing your work - it is a hard stop and you need to fix the error before you can proceed. A warning message will stop your work, however, you can then bypass the warning by pressing the Enter key on your keyboard. That said, it is still good practice to investigate the cause of the warning message and address it. An information message will not stop your work and is truly just for informational purposes.
